There's still a lot of Double stuff unreleased. One of the big one's that didn't get much attention was Baby's On Fire by David Lord (aka David Srb [Delta Force, King Kobra, Disco Vega, David Road]), Because The Night by Christine, and many others. This was proven by the Euroenergy albums that had a bunch of unreleased Double stuff on them (most surprising were the Gianni Coraini SCP/Double releases).drnrg wrote:GruzkyI might be mistaken, but I thought the Double records stuff had been all released?
